Basic Information

Item Details
Product Name Hmbatsc
CAS No. 51146-75-9
Molecular Formula C10H12N2O2S
Molecular Weight 224.28 g/mol
Synonyms 2-Hydroxy-3-methoxybenzaldehyde thiosemicarbazone; 2-Hydroxy-3-methoxybenzylidenehydrazinecarbothioamide; HMBATSC; o-Vanillin thiosemicarbazone; 2-Hydroxy-3-methoxybenzaldehyde N-thiosemicarbazone; (E)-2-(2-Hydroxy-3-methoxybenzylidene)hydrazine-1-carbothioamide

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from incompatible materials such as strong oxidizing agents.
